Tohana: Panchayat Minister Devendra Babli said that the boundary of Tohana Municipal Council has been expanded by around 5.86 square kilometers around the town. A notification in this regard has also been issued by the Haryana government. By expanding the boundaries of the local council, basic amenities such as street lights, paved roads, etc. will also be available to citizens. The development of the urban area will accelerate.

The Panchayat Minister heard the grievances of the citizens regarding various departments including Cadara, Electricity, Agriculture, Panchayati Raj, Public Health, Irrigation Department, Property Pass and directed the local officials to resolve the same within the time limit. He urged officials to work as a team and solve the public’s problems. Solve public problems as a priority, do not be careless in this matter. After 15 days, a meeting will be held with the officials to discuss the issues at the Janata Darbar. While resolving the issues related to the Electricity Department, he directed the officials that citizens should not have to travel repeatedly for the services related to the Electricity Department.

While dismissing the complaints related to disability pension and BPL ration card, he said that a citizen’s ration card will not be reduced. All citizens whose names have been removed from their ration cards will be corrected soon. He directed the police to check drug abuse and curb thefts. In response to the elderly woman’s complaint, he gave instructions to reinstall the meter. At the request of a woman, he helped her daughter receive a year-long coaching session using his personal funds. Instructions have been given to resolve the water problem in Chitain village within three months.
